We didn't see the rooms but it was reasonably central. There is a free bus in Perth and also one in Fremantle that does a circuit of the city and you can hop on and off. Also Perth is not that big a city, we found it quite walkable. Don't miss Freo, I fell in love with the place, much nicer than Perth. You can catch a train from Perth to Freo or catch a ferry down the Swan River, we did the ferry option one way with a wine tasting and caught the train back.

The hotel is located on the corner of Pier and Murray Streets and is very central - about 2 minutes walk from the Murray Street mall where you will find Myer and David Jones and all the other stores. There is a free bus service that goes around Perth called the CAT (Central Area Transit). I think there are three routes, you can hop on and off. The stops are clearly marked and have a voice sensor that tells you how long until the next bus. You are also 5 minutes from the City train and bus stations.

I can't comment on the rooms but Miss Maud makes wonderful pastries and cakes that are very popular.
